Trading FX using Range
As we all know we can choose to trade using Minutes, Day, Month, Year, Volume or Range. When I place a strategy to trade using a specific Range as for example 100 pip Range, I don't see it working as it does when I use Minutes or Day.

Let say that the strategy states the following:
-----------------------
if Close [0] > Close[1]
//Do something
-----------------------
This strategy works well when placing it using any Minutes chart or Day chart, but when selecting the Range chart for let say 100 pips, orders don't get placed even though "if Close [0] > Close[1]".

...unless your data source has pipettes (sub pip support) and your utilizing them then 100 range is actually just 10 regular sized pips.Originally posted by Cyborg View PostFor Fx Range 100 is to way too large amount .Try to use range 5 max 15.Works fine for me in 8-12 range for scalping Fx.
